3-D Archery Shoot - Mosquito Bowmen

September 5, 2010

CORTLAND, OH — The Mosquito Bowmen, Conservation League Inc. will hold a 3-D Archery Shoot the first Sunday of each month until Sept. 5, 2010. The cost is $10 for adults and $5 for youths. Registration 8 a.m.-12 p.m. Like new McKenzie targets with nicely groomed course. For inf. more »
